Do you need both parents permission to change a childs name by deed poll?
The consent of each person with parental responsibility is required in order to change the name of a child who is under the age of 16. The application forms to change a childs name via deed poll can be located on the gov.uk website.
Can I change my childs last name if I have full custody in California?
Yes. Both parents have the right to know about a request to change their childs name. You must let the other parent know, even if you have sole custody of your child.
How much does it cost to change your childs name in California?
To start the process, you file forms with the court You pay a $435-$450 filing fee. If you cant afford the fee, you can ask the court to waive it. The clerk will give you a date when a judge will make a decision.

Can I change my childs surname without dads permission?
Can I Change the Surname of my Child if I have Parental Responsibility? If you have sole parental responsibility, you will be able to change your childs name without anyone elses consent or Court approval. However, you will still need to seek legal advice from a solicitor to make a formal deed to change their name.
Can I change my childs last name without fathers consent in California?
In California, you can ask the court to legally change your childs name. If you are the only parent making the request, you have to file a petition with the court, let the other parent know about it, and go to a court hearing. If your childs other parent does not agree, they have the right to oppose your request.
